Description from owner

Description

This beautifully-appointed open plan ground floor apartment is positioned right in the heart of the quaint harbour town of Mousehole, West Cornwall. Perfectly positioned for a taste of village life, it’s just moments from the harbours edge, and close to local restaurants and pubs, making it an ideal retreat for couples.

Steeped in mystery and myth, this studio formally known as “Who Knows” once functioned as a fish cellar, where mariners would come to process their catch. Now 300 years on, a mix of clever craftsmanship and exquisite interiors has transformed this industrial cellar into a unique Boutique Retreat.

Parking

Like most properties in Mousehole, The Old Fish Cellar doesn’t have it’s own allocated parking space, however you can do a bag drop outside and then parking is available in either of the harbour car parks for £3 a day or £15 for a week.
